Key Properties
−| Source | E.coli |
|---|---|
| Biological Origin | Homo sapiens (Human) |
| Biological Activity | The ED50 as determined in a cell proliferation assay using Balb/3T3 mouse embryonic fibroblast cells is 1-5 ng/ml. |
| Tag | Tag-Free |
| Expression Region | 1-208aa |
| Protein Length | Full Length |
| Endotoxins | Less than 1.0 EU/µg as determined by LAL method. |
| MW | 23.44 kDa |
| Purity | Greater than 95% as determined by SDS-PAGE. |
| Protein Sequence | MAPLGEVGNYFGVQDAVPFGNVPVLPVDSPVLLSDHLGQSEAGGLPRGPAVTDLDHLKGILRRRQLYCRTGFHLEIFPNGTIQGTRKDHSRFGILEFISIAVGLVSIRGVDSGLYLGMNEKGELYGSEKLTQECVFREQFEENWYNTYSSNLYKHVDTGRRYYVALNKDGTPREGTRTKRHQKFTHFLPRPVDPDKVPELYKDILSQS |
Storage & Handling
−| Storage | The shelf life is related to many factors, storage state, buffer ingredients, storage temperature and the stability of the protein itself. Generally, the shelf life of liquid form is 6 months at -20℃/-80℃. The shelf life of lyophilized form is 12 months at -20℃/-80℃. |
|---|---|
| Form/Appearance | Lyophilized powder |
| Buffer/Preservatives | Lyophilized from a 0.2 μm filtered 20 mM PB, 150 mM NaCl, 5% Trehalos, pH 7.4 |
| Expiration Date | 6 months from date of receipt. |
| Disclaimer | For research use only |
Alternative Names
−Fibroblast Growth Factor 9; FGF-9; Glia-Activating Factor; GAF; Heparin-Binding Growth Factor 9; HBGF-9; FGF9
